Título: |
Qualidade do sêmen em tilápia do Nilo (Oreochromis niloticus), alimentadas com dietas contendo diferentes níveis de vitamina C. |

Conteúdo: |
A vitamina C atua na proteção de danos celulares provocados pelos radicais livres, sendo a suplementação considerada essencial para a maioria das espécies de peixes, uma vez que não a sintetizam em função da ausência da enzima L-gulonolactona oxidase. Assim, avaliou-se o efeito da suplementação de 0, 75, 150 e 225 mg de vitamina C kg-1 de ração na qualidade do sêmen em tilápias do Nilo (Oreochromis niloticus). Os parâmetros quali-quantitativos do sêmen não foram influenciados pela suplementação de vitamina C, exceto a motilidade progressiva que aumentou linearmente com adição de vitamina C. Conclui-se que os reprodutores de tilápias do Nilo devem ser suplementados com 225 mg de vitamina C kg-1 de ração. |

Título: |
Herbicide alternatives for 2,4-D in no-till cropping systems. |

Conteúdo: |
The mixture of 2,4-D with other herbicides such as glyphosate, sulfosate or paraquatis a common practice all over the country in Brazil. Theobjective is to enhance the efficiency of control of broadleaf weed and to reduce costs in no-till crop systems. However, many problems havebeen registered due to drifts of 2,4-Dover economic crops as cotton, grapes and vegetables. In the State of Parana, about 40 countries have forbidden its use because of damage caused to neighbouring crops. In order to find herbicide alternatives for 2,4-D in risk areas, one experiment was conducted in Londrina, Parana State, Brazil in small plots having weed species such as Commelina benghalensis L., Bidens spp. and Euphorbia heterophylla L.. The treatments consisted of glyphosate alone and mistures with 2,4-D, flumioxazin, sulfentrzone, glufosinate-ammonium or chlorimuron-ethyl. Paraquat plus diuron was also used in tank mix with diquat, 2,4-D, or flumioxazin, besides flumioxazin alone and an untreated cleck. The experiment was conducted in a block desing, with plots of 2m x 5m, with four replications. Aplication was made with a CO2 equipment, using 207 kPa of pressure, nozzles 110.015-BD and spray volume of 160 L ha -1. Weed control evaluations were made at 8 and 15 DAA (days after application) and for C. benghalensis, also at 33 DAA. For this species, at 15 DAA, treatments with paraquat + diuron in mixture with 2,4-D, diquat or with flumioxazin were not statistically different from glyphosate + 2,4-D (chck). At 33 DAA, those and glyphosate + flumioxazin (1.44 + 0.025 kg ha -1) presente the same behaviour. All substitutive treatments were efficient to control the other two weed species.
